The Rental Fleet Condition Monitoring Supervisor is responsible for overseeing the health and performance of the rental equipment fleet through proactive monitoring, customer communication, and technical response. The CM Supervisor plays a key role in fleet utilization by proactively dispatching techs to alerts and ensuring rental units are maintained in optimal operating condition. The goal is to minimize downtime, extend asset life, and deliver exceptional service to rental customers.
